Caren Hanson Obituary

Caren E Hanson (nee Dingman), age 79 of Richfield departed the bonds of earth to find peace on November 14, 2023. Predeceased by parents Stuart M and Edith J Dingman, and brother Steven S. Beloved wife of Robert J Hanson since their marriage in Whitefish Bay, WI in 1966. A graduate of UWM with a degree in music education, Caren held numerous positions with universities and non-profits as an administrative assistant retiring from BMO Harris in 2012, all the while partnering with her husband in their antique and numismatic business. A lyric soprano with her basso husband Bob, they sang in many choral groups for decades. 

Loving mother of Erica (Dario) Elia of Shorewood, and Jon (Megan) Hanson of Portland, Oregon. Proud grandma of Ansley Elia. Further survived by brother Michael (Susan) Dingman of Racine, sister Jane (Dr James) Kircher of Shorewood, and many nieces and nephews. A celebration of life memorial service is being planned for early 2024 at Northshore Funeral Services Chapel, 3601 N. Oakland Avenue, Shorewood, Wi 53211. Memorials may be made to the Hartford Community Chorus and mailed to Robert Hanson, PO Box 117, Richfield, WI 53076.
